The Benefits of Bedsharing, by Dr. Helen Ball of the Durham University Parent-Infant Sleep Lab, midwife Sally Inch, and Marion Copeland, is a concise, easy-to-understand presentation on how to safely bedshare, and why the practice is good for mother, baby, and the breastfeeding relationship. (Mark-It-Television, 2005; www.platypusmedia.com)
Reviewed by Melissa Chianta
